Description: The search for new cultivars combining resistance or tolerance to pests and diseases, high productivity and organoleptic characteristics similar to the traditionally grown crops is the major objective of banana breeding. This work med to evaluate the production of different banana genotypes under Ribeira Valley conditions, Brazil. The experiment was carried out in a randomized design with 20 treatments (banana genotypes) and eight repetitions.
